Direct (Scope 1) and energy indirect (Scope 2) greenhouse gas emissions (in tonnes) and, where appropriate, intensity (e.g. per unit of production volume, per facility).
Indicator | Unit | 2021 | 2022 | 2023 | Report Pages |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
Annual carbon dioxide emissions reduction at PICC North Information Center after refrigeration system upgrade | tons | 340 | 22 | ||
Annual carbon emissions reduction at PICC North Information Center by replacing boiler heating with waste heat recovery | tons | 730 | 22 | ||
Electricity emissions (CO2e) - Scope 2 | t | 11592.52 | 13128.65 | 12929.94 | 24 |
Employee travel (train and aviation) emissions (CO2e) - Scope 3 | t | 152.56 | 223.85 | 571.38 | 24 |
Gasoline combustion emissions (CO2e) - Scope 1 | t | 184.94 | 141.78 | 169.67 | 24 |
Heat emissions (CO2e) - Scope 2 | t | 3835.55 | 3900.70 | 4391.83 | 24 |
Natural gas combustion emissions (CO2e) - Scope 1 | t | 472.32 | 428.76 | 465.48 | 24 |
Per capita emissions (CO2e/person) | t | 2.50 | 2.33 | 2.11 | 24 |
Total emissions (CO2e) | t | 16237.89 | 17823.74 | 18528.30 | 24 |

Direct and/or indirect energy consumption by type (e.g. electricity, gas or oil) in total (kWh in '000s) and intensity (e.g. per unit of production volume, per facility).
Indicator | Unit | 2021 | 2022 | 2023 | Report Pages |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
Electricity consumption (Group Company and subsidiaries) | kWh | 19406140.0 | 21119621.0 | 21784835.5 | 23 |
Electricity consumption per capita (Group Company and subsidiaries) | kWh | 2992.5 | 2765.0 | 2475.8 | 23 |
Gasoline consumption of official vehicles (Group Company and subsidiaries) | Liters | 82920.2 | 63072.8 | 74788.8 | 23 |
Natural gas consumption (Group Company and subsidiaries) | m³ | 218278.0 | 191615.0 | 215075.0 | 23 |
Natural gas consumption per capita (Group Company and subsidiaries) | m³ | 33.7 | 25.9 | 24.5 | 23 |
Purchased heat consumption (Headquarters building) | GJ | 34609.7 | 34560.9 | 35925.7 | 23 |
Water consumption in total and intensity (e.g. per unit of production volume, per facility).
Indicator | Unit | 2021 | 2022 | 2023 | Report Pages |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
Drinking water consumption (Group Company and subsidiaries, excluding PICC Hong Kong, PICC Financial Services, and PICC Technology) | t | 497.2 | 412.5 | 518.6 | 23 |
Per capita water consumption (Group Company and subsidiaries, excluding PICC Hong Kong, PICC Financial Services, and PICC Technology) | t | 14.1 | 11.2 | 10.0 | 23 |
Reclaimed water consumption (Group Company and subsidiaries, excluding PICC Hong Kong, PICC Financial Services, and PICC Technology) | t | 4335.7 | 3986.0 | 1802.0 | 23 |
Tap water consumption (Group Company and subsidiaries, excluding PICC Hong Kong, PICC Financial Services, and PICC Technology) | t | 91032.0 | 85225.0 | 87684.4 | 23 |

Total workforce by gender, employment type (for example, full- or part-time), age group and geographical region.
Indicator | Unit | 2021 | 2022 | 2023 | Report Pages |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
Number of dispatched employees | persons | 13562 | 14683 | 15785 | 26 |
Number of on-the-job employees | persons | 184364 | 177852 | 175881 | 26 |
Number of on-the-job employees by age: 31-50 years old | persons | 124235 | 125468 | 127934 | 26 |
Number of on-the-job employees by age: <31 years old | persons | 38234 | 28977 | 25832 | 26 |
Number of on-the-job employees by age: >50 years old | persons | 21895 | 22507 | 22115 | 26 |
Number of on-the-job employees by degree: Associate degree | persons | 51713 | 45833 | 41703 | 26 |
Number of on-the-job employees by degree: Bachelor's degree | persons | 112846 | 113432 | 115964 | 26 |
Number of on-the-job employees by degree: Master's degree and above | persons | 9395 | 9715 | 10760 | 26 |
Number of on-the-job employees by degree: Others | persons | 10447 | 8872 | 7434 | 26 |
Number of on-the-job employees by gender: Female | persons | 88657 | 85386 | 85132 | 26 |
Number of on-the-job employees by gender: Male | persons | 95707 | 92468 | 90749 | 26 |
Number of salespersons | persons | 470937 | 375566 | 359097 | 26 |
Regional composition of on-the-job employees: Domestic | persons | 184300 | 177785 | 175816 | 26 |
Regional composition of on-the-job employees: Overseas | persons | 64 | 67 | 65 | 26 |
